Search For :
al ain ، Abu Dhabi
Alshoala Cars Spring Workshop Industrial Area received a rating of 3.8 through 112 visitor
Review Now
Bad Satisfactory Good Very Good Excellent
Please.. Be honest in your review, many rely on reviews to have decisions.
street 118 , near al ain class motors
Tyre Repair Equipment & Supplies
volkswagen, porsche & audi showroom & service centre, street 118
New Car Dealers
chevrolet & gmc main showroom, street 118 , near adnoc
New Car Dealers
service center chevrolet & gmc, hessa bint mohammed street
Car Dealers
spare parts division, al ain street (street 118) , near lulu supermarket
Motorcycles & Motor Scooters Supplies & Parts